Analysis

Bhutan recorded 25.20 billion for foreign assets, net foreign assets in 2007. That is the highest value across all 25 years on record.

The figure is up 5.0% on the previous year and up 243.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, foreign assets, net foreign assets in Bhutan peaked at 25.20 billion in 2007 and was at its lowest, 345.70 million, in 1983.

Bhutan ranks 112th of 178 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Foreign Assets, Net Foreign Assets in Bhutan, year by year

Annual values for Foreign Assets, Net Foreign Assets (Depository Corporations Survey, Domestic currency) in Bhutan, 1983 to 2007.
Year Value Change
1983 345.70 million
1984 490.20 million +41.8%
1985 595.40 million +21.5%
1986 700.10 million +17.6%
1987 1.08 billion +53.8%
1988 1.38 billion +28.6%
1989 1.45 billion +4.5%
1990 1.49 billion +2.9%
1991 2.48 billion +66.7%
1992 1.88 billion -24.1%
1993 2.81 billion +49.3%
1994 3.19 billion +13.6%
1995 4.43 billion +38.7%
1996 6.58 billion +48.6%
1997 7.35 billion +11.6%
1998 10.85 billion +47.7%
1999 12.91 billion +19.0%
2000 15.08 billion +16.8%
2001 14.64 billion -2.9%
2002 17.01 billion +16.2%
2003 16.79 billion -1.3%
2004 17.34 billion +3.3%
2005 21.02 billion +21.2%
2006 23.99 billion +14.1%
2007 25.20 billion +5.0%
